I know that it's a little early for Halloween, but I stumbled across stories on the New England Vampire Panic, which occurred in the early 19th Century.  Apparently, the spread of tuberculosis led some rural New Englanders to believe that vampires were stalking their families, which lead to them taking some extreme actions to prevent the stalking.  https://historyofyesterday.com/new-englands-vampire-panic-7bea4aff9180

Of the two most notorious cases, Mercy Brown is already on the tree and I added Frederick Ransom.

I normally don't spend much time on vampires, but I find it fascinating that this type of thing was going on in New England at that time.  It's not how we picture New England.
